Disability shower installation services involve customizing bathroom showers to better accommodate individuals with mobility challenges or other physical limitations. These installations typically include features such as low or no-threshold entryways, grab bars, seating options, and non-slip surfaces. The goal is to create a safer, more accessible bathing environment that reduces the risk of slips and falls, making daily routines easier and more comfortable for those with disabilities or aging in place. Experienced contractors in the area can assess existing bathrooms and recommend modifications that meet specific needs, ensuring a practical and functional upgrade.
This service helps address common problems faced by individuals with limited mobility, such as difficulty stepping over high tub walls or maneuvering in tight, slippery spaces. Traditional showers may pose safety hazards or be difficult to access without assistance. Disability shower installations provide a solution by removing barriers and adding supportive features that promote independence. These upgrades can also be beneficial for caregivers, who may find it easier to assist with bathing when the shower area is designed for safety and ease of use.

The overview below groups typical Disability Shower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Mahopac, NY.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Many routine shower modifications for accessibility in Mahopac, NY, typically cost between $250 and $600. These projects often involve installing grab bars or minor adjustments and tend to fall within the middle of this range.
Partial or Custom Installations - More involved modifications, such as custom seating or non-standard fixtures, usually range from $600 to $2,000. These projects are common but can vary depending on specific design choices and existing bathroom setups.
Full Shower Replacement - Complete replacement of a shower for accessibility can typically cost between $2,000 and $5,000. Larger, more complex projects with custom features or structural changes may push costs higher, but most fall within this range.
Complex or Large-Scale Projects - Extensive modifications or multi-room installations can exceed $5,000, especially when significant structural work or high-end materials are involved. These projects are less common but represent the upper end of typical costs for disability shower installations in the area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of disability shower installations are available? Local contractors can install various accessible shower options, including roll-in showers, walk-in showers, and barrier-free designs tailored to individual needs.
How can a disability shower improve safety in the bathroom? Properly installed accessible showers feature safety elements such as grab bars, non-slip flooring, and seating options to reduce the risk of slips and falls.
Are there different shower styles suitable for mobility aids? Yes, service providers can install spacious, barrier-free showers that accommodate wheelchairs, walkers, or other mobility devices comfortably.
What should be considered when planning a disability shower installation? Factors include the shower's size, accessibility features, plumbing requirements, and compatibility with existing bathroom layouts.
